Im looking at getting a 6.5x12 with a ramp door. Questions is weather to get it unfinished or finished. Anybody with experience, pros/cons let me know what you think. If I finish it, whats the best interior option, Im thinking tongue and groove cedar planking, its light compared to carsiding. And what's the best way to attach it to the walls? Looking at some pics an videos, it looks like the manufacturer use brad nails, seems kinda weak to me

Also, what about the floor. I know the yeti edge sport (model Im thinking of if I just buy a finished one) has an insulated floor. Also read somewhere that sandwiching foam between two pieces of plywood is not a good idea for the floor. I think that's what yeti does to insulate floor.

Any ideas or comments are appreciated

I finished mine myself. It's nice to plan your entire layout yourself, but then you don't have anyone else to blame if it ends up being a pain where something is located in the house. wink

Finish nails hold up the cedar planking just fine. I used rubber nickel mat for the flooring. Yetti does not finish houses, that is done by the individual dealers on the houses that are finished. Yes they do the sandwiched floor when they insulate the floors, I had the bottom of my floor spray foamed between the frame tubing. This way you have no insulation where the tubing is though (not a big deal just something to keep in mind). Any thickness you add on top of the floor makes your house that much higher off the water and loses ceiling height. Just something to keep in mind.

I have an 8X16 Yetti. If you look at the floor it is recessed about 1 3/4" below the door opening, perfect for 1" of insulation and 1/2" plywood, this leaves you about a 1/4 " for your finished floor. This is what the custom finisher do to insulate the floor. Do it yourself,and have some fun

      On the south end...   The big basin, otherwise known as Big Traverse Bay, is ice free.  Zippel Bay and Four Mile Bay are ice free as well.  Everything is shaping up nicely for the MN Fishing Opener on May 11th. With the walleye / sauger season currently closed, most anglers are targeting sturgeon and pike.  Some sturgeon anglers are fishing at the mouth of the Rainy River, but most sturgeon are targeted in Four Mile Bay or the Rainy River.  Hence, pike are the targeted species on the south shore and various bays currently.   Pike fishing this time of year is a unique opportunity, as LOW is border water with Canada, the pike season is open year round. The limit is 3 pike per day with one being able to be more than 40 inches. All fish 30 - 40 inches must be released. Back bays hold pike as they go through the various stages of the spawn.  Deadbait under a bobber, spinners, spoons and shallow diving crankbaits are all viable options.   Four Mile Bay, Bostic Bay and Zippel Bay are all small water and boats of various sizes work well. On the Rainy River...  Great news this week as we learned sturgeon will not be placed on the endangered species list by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service.     The organization had to make a decision by June 30 and listing sturgeon could have ended sturgeon fishing.  Thankfully, after looking at the many success stories across the nation, including LOW and the Rainy River, sturgeon fishing and successful sturgeon management continues.   A good week sturgeon fishing on the Rainy River.  Speaking to some sturgeon aficionados, fishing will actually get even better as water temps rise.     Four Mile Bay at the mouth of the Rainy River near the Wheeler's Point Boat Ramp is still producing good numbers of fish, as are various holes along the 42 miles of navigable Rainy River from the mouth to Birchdale.   The sturgeon season continues through May 15th and resumes again July 1st.   Oct 1 - April 23, Catch and Release April 24 - May 7, Harvest Season May 8 - May 15, Catch and Release May 16 - June 30, Sturgeon Fishing Closed July 1 - Sep 30, Harvest Season If you fish during the sturgeon harvest season and you want to keep a sturgeon, you must purchase a sturgeon tag for $5 prior to fishing.    One sturgeon per calendar year (45 - 50" inclusive, or over 75"). Most sturgeon anglers are either a glob of crawlers or a combo of crawlers and frozen emerald shiners on a sturgeon rig, which is an 18" leader with a 4/0 circle hook combined with a no roll sinker.  Local bait shops have all of the gear and bait. Up at the NW Angle...  A few spots with rotten ice, but as a rule, most of the Angle is showing off open water.  In these parts, most are looking ahead to the MN Fishing Opener.  Based on late ice fishing success, it should be a good one.
